Cryptocurrencies have had a difficult time shaking off the image of scandal and blow-ups that followed the events of 2022. To achieve mainstream adoption, the crypto industry must explain the purpose of digital assets and offer tangible, easy-to-grasp products and services that consumers actually want. As Michelle O’Connor, Vice President of Brand and Global Communications at TaxBit, said, “I would love for us to start talking about the technology more, and real-world use cases.”
However, the industry struggles to communicate the broader benefits of crypto in a way that resonates. Caitlin Cook, Head of Marketing and Communications at Hxro Labs, noted, “How can you get people to buy into a system that they don’t understand on multiple levels?” The irony is that the core technology of crypto is designed to be trustless, so there should be no capacity for bad actors to do harm and thus no image problem. But the collapse of FTX and other 2022 events showed that people were putting their trust in organizations that may not have deserved it.
